14 lines
364 B
CMake
14 lines
364 B
CMake
cmake_minimum_required(VERSION 3.10)
|
|
project(rvscc)
|
|
include(ExternalProject)
|
|
|
|
ExternalProject_Add(firmware
|
|
SOURCE_DIR ${CMAKE_CURRENT_SOURCE_DIR}/fw
|
|
BINARY_DIR ${CMAKE_CURRENT_SOURCE_DIR}/fw/build
|
|
CMAKE_ARGS -DCMAKE_TOOLCHAIN_FILE=${CMAKE_CURRENT_SOURCE_DIR}/fw/cmake/riscv-toolchain.cmake
|
|
STEP_TARGETS build
|
|
INSTALL_COMMAND ""
|
|
)
|
|
|
|
add_subdirectory(test)
|